Best Placement for Pajama Embroidery

Pajamas = comfort first.
So, you should place embroidery where it doesn’t rub the skin while sleeping.

Best areas

  • upper chest (left side, near shoulder)

  • small emblem on breast pocket

  • lower edge of pants leg

  • small design near hip

  • sleeve edge near wrist

Avoid these areas

  • center of chest

  • belly area

  • upper back

  • inner legs

  • side seams

These places bend, stretch, and rub the skin during the night — irritation guaranteed.


What Size Should Pajama Embroidery Be?

For maximum comfort:

  • Small designs: 6–10 cm high

  • Pocket designs: 3–6 cm

  • Pant leg designs: 8–12 cm

  • Kid pajamas: 5–8 cm

Large designs look beautiful but stiffen the fabric — not ideal for sleep.


Silk vs Acrylic Threads: What to Choose?

Thread Type

Pros

Cons

Silk Thread

Ultra-soft 💛, smooth on skin, luxury look, hypoallergenic

Expensive, delicate to wash, not ideal for beginners

Acrylic Thread (Rayon/Polyester)

Affordable, strong, bright colors, machine washable

Slightly stiffer, may feel rough if used in large fill areas

Verdict:
Use silk for premium adult pajamas
Use rayon/polyester for kids and daily-use pajamas


What Fabrics Work Best for Embroidered Pajamas?

Here’s a quick comparison:

Fabric

Pros

Cons

Cotton Jersey

Soft, breathable, easy to embroider

Stretches — needs stabilizer

Flannel

Warm, cozy, holds stitches well

Can shrink if not prewashed

Silk Satin

Luxurious, ideal for small monograms

Slippery, requires careful hooping

Bamboo Fabric

Eco-friendly, soft, hypoallergenic

Can curl at edges during embroidery

Poly-blend Pajamas

Durable, colors don’t fade

Can feel less breathable


Seller & Designer Tips (Blocks)

🟦 Designer Tip

“Keep the design light! Too many dense stitches will make the pajama stiff and uncomfortable. Choose airy sketch-style embroidery.”


🟩 Seller Tip

“Always reinforce stretchy fabric with soft tear-away or no-show mesh stabilizer. It prevents puckering and keeps stitches smooth.”


🟪 Pro Tip

“Place embroidery where the body doesn’t press against the bed. This prevents friction and keeps the pajama feeling soft.”

How to Embroider Pajamas: Step-by-Step

1️⃣ Prewash the pajamas to avoid shrinkage
2️⃣ Choose a soft stabilizer (no-show mesh is perfect)
3️⃣ Hoop the pajama area gently — don't stretch it
4️⃣ Use lightweight designs
5️⃣ Use silk or rayon thread for softness
6️⃣ Clip all jump stitches carefully
7️⃣ Test-wash before gifting
